Talbert v. Judiciary of State of New Jersey
181 L. Ed. 2d 140, 132 S. Ct. 244, 565 U.S. 879, 2011 U.S. LEXIS 5621, 80 U.S.L.W. 3187, 113 Fair Empl. Prac. Cas. (BNA) 704

Opinion
Petition for writ of certiorari to the United States Court of Appeals for the Third Circuit denied.
Same case below, 420 Fed. Appx. 140.
